# File 'lib/px4_log_reader/log_file.rb', line 28

def self.read_descriptor( buffered_io, skip_corrupt=true )

      message_descriptor = nil

  begin

descriptor_message = read_message( buffered_io, FORMAT_DESCRIPTOR_TABLE )

if descriptor_message

  message_descriptor = Px4LogReader::MessageDescriptor.new
  message_descriptor.from_message( descriptor_message )

end

      rescue Px4LogReader::InvalidDescriptorError => error

if skip_corrupt
  retry
else
  raise error
end

      rescue StandardError => e
puts "#{e.class}: #{e.message}"
puts e.backtrace.join("\n")
      end

      return message_descriptor
end

# File 'lib/px4_log_reader/log_file.rb', line 10

def self.read_descriptors( buffered_io, descriptor_cache=nil )

  message_descriptors = {}

  while ( message_descriptor = read_descriptor( buffered_io ) ) do
    if !message_descriptors.keys.include? message_descriptor.type
      message_descriptors[ message_descriptor.type ] = message_descriptor
    end
  end

  # If a cache filename was supplied, dump the descriptors to the cache
  if descriptor_cache
    descriptor_cache.write_descriptors( message_descriptors )
  end

  return message_descriptors
end

# File 'lib/px4_log_reader/log_file.rb', line 59

def self.read_message( buffered_io, message_descriptors )

      message = nil
      while message.nil? do
message_type = read_message_header( buffered_io )

if message_type

  message_descriptor = message_descriptors[ message_type ]

  if message_descriptor
    message_data = buffered_io.read( message_descriptor.length - HEADER_LENGTH )
    message = message_descriptor.unpack_message( message_data )
  end

elsif message_type.nil?
  break
end
      end

      return message
end

# File 'lib/px4_log_reader/log_file.rb', line 82

def self.read_message_header( buffered_io )
   message_type = nil

   begin

      data = buffered_io.read(2)

      if data && data.length == 2

         while !data.empty? && message_type.nil? do

          if ( byte = buffered_io.read(1) )
             data << byte
          end

            if data.unpack('CCC')[0,2] == HEADER_MARKER
               message_type = data.unpack('CCC').last & 0xFF
            else
               data = data[1..-1]
            end

         end
      end

   rescue EOFError => error
      # Nothing to do.
   rescue StandardError => error
      puts error.message
      puts error.backtrace.join("\n")
   end

   return message_type
end

# File 'lib/px4_log_reader/log_file.rb', line 117

def self.write_message( io, message )
  io.write HEADER_MARKER.pack('CC')
  io.write [ message.descriptor.type ].pack('C')
  io.write message.pack
end
